package com.android.internal.inputmethod;

import android.annotation.AnyThread;
import android.annotation.NonNull;
import android.os.Bundle;
import android.os.RemoteException;
import android.view.KeyEvent;
import android.view.inputmethod.CompletionInfo;
import android.view.inputmethod.CorrectionInfo;
import android.view.inputmethod.ExtractedTextRequest;
import android.view.inputmethod.InputContentInfo;

import com.android.internal.view.IInputContext;

import java.util.Objects;

/**
 * A stateless wrapper of {@link com.android.internal.view.IInputContext} to encapsulate boilerplate
 * code around {@link Completable} and {@link RemoteException}.
 */
public final class IInputContextInvoker {

    @NonNull
    private final IInputContext mIInputContext;

    private IInputContextInvoker(@NonNull IInputContext inputContext) {
        mIInputContext = inputContext;
    }

    /**
     * Creates a new instance of {@link IInputContextInvoker} for the given {@link IInputContext}.
     *
     * @param inputContext {@link IInputContext} to be wrapped.
     * @return A new instance of {@link IInputContextInvoker}.
     */
    public static IInputContextInvoker create(@NonNull IInputContext inputContext) {
        Objects.requireNonNull(inputContext);
        return new IInputContextInvoker(inputContext);
    }

    /**
     * Invokes {@link IInputContext#getTextAfterCursor(int, int,
     * com.android.internal.inputmethod.ICharSequenceResultCallback)}.
     *
     * @param length {@code length} parameter to be passed.
     * @param flags {@code flags} parameter to be passed.
     * @return {@link Completable.CharSequence} that can be used to retrieve the invocation result.
     *         {@link RemoteException} will be treated as an error.
     */
    @AnyThread
    @NonNull
    public Completable.CharSequence getTextAfterCursor(int length, int flags) {
        final Completable.CharSequence value = Completable.createCharSequence();
        try {
            mIInputContext.getTextAfterCursor(length, flags, ResultCallbacks.of(value));
        } catch (RemoteException e) {
            value.onError(ThrowableHolder.of(e));
        }
        return value;
    }

    /**
     * Invokes {@link IInputContext#getTextBeforeCursor(int, int, ICharSequenceResultCallback)}.
     *
     * @param length {@code length} parameter to be passed.
     * @param flags {@code flags} parameter to be passed.
     * @return {@link Completable.CharSequence} that can be used to retrieve the invocation result.
     *         {@link RemoteException} will be treated as an error.
     */
    @AnyThread
    @NonNull
    public Completable.CharSequence getTextBeforeCursor(int length, int flags) {
        final Completable.CharSequence value = Completable.createCharSequence();
        try {
            mIInputContext.getTextBeforeCursor(length, flags, ResultCallbacks.of(value));
        } catch (RemoteException e) {
            value.onError(ThrowableHolder.of(e));
        }
        return value;
    }

    /**
     * Invokes {@link IInputContext#getSelectedText(int, ICharSequenceResultCallback)}.
     *
     * @param flags {@code flags} parameter to be passed.
     * @return {@link Completable.CharSequence} that can be used to retrieve the invocation result.
     *         {@link RemoteException} will be treated as an error.
     */
    @AnyThread
    @NonNull
    public Completable.CharSequence getSelectedText(int flags) {
        final Completable.CharSequence value = Completable.createCharSequence();
        try {
            mIInputContext.getSelectedText(flags, ResultCallbacks.of(value));
        } catch (RemoteException e) {
            value.onError(ThrowableHolder.of(e));
        }
        return value;
    }

    /**
     * Invokes
     * {@link IInputContext#getSurroundingText(int, int, int, ISurroundingTextResultCallback)}.
     *
     * @param beforeLength {@code beforeLength} parameter to be passed.
     * @param afterLength {@code afterLength} parameter to be passed.
     * @param flags {@code flags} parameter to be passed.
     * @return {@link Completable.SurroundingText} that can be used to retrieve the invocation
     *         result. {@link RemoteException} will be treated as an error.
     */
    @AnyThread
    @NonNull
    public Completable.SurroundingText getSurroundingText(int beforeLength, int afterLength,
            int flags) {
        final Completable.SurroundingText value = Completable.createSurroundingText();
        try {
            mIInputContext.getSurroundingText(beforeLength, afterLength, flags,
                    ResultCallbacks.of(value));
        } catch (RemoteException e) {
            value.onError(ThrowableHolder.of(e));
        }
        return value;
    }
